I just read through the Brighthand review of the new NZ model, and realized a moment ago that the only way you will ever get a separate, full size keyboard (like the Stowaway) for it is if Sony designs and releases it by itself... the HotSync port is on the back of the NZ, rather than on the bottom like all other devices created so far. It's even up towards the top of the back, near the bump for the camera, according to the review. That means that any of the usual keyboards that have been released just plain won't work at all with this model, even if it happens to still use the T-series connector type. I'm sure some kind of adapter could be created if needed, but I really doubt that the NZ will have an external keyboard of the quality of the Stowaways anytime soon... that, in itself, is yet another reason that I will never buy an NZ.

I'm still waiting for a version of the new Stowaway XT to be released for my T665C, but at least I can always get a regular Stowaway in the mean time... the NZ just seems completely out of luck though. They probably have plans for a Bluetooth keyboard of some kind, but who knows what kind of quality it will be.
